Extending ngmodel to hidden fields by stsvilik pull. Angular also doesnt provide framework support to ajax upload of file right now i believe. I was using ngmodel on my hidden inputs for the exact use case described in this pr, and i, perhaps naively, assumed everything was working properly because i could change the input type to text and observe the data binding. Use the following command to install bootstrap in the project. This is the effortless way to port the sharepoint list data or any other list data to carry, print, and make a hard copy. The angular microsyntax lets you configure a directive in a compact, friendly string. Angularjs extends html attributes with directives, and binds data to html with expressions. Angular directive tutorial with example custom directives edureka. Input control follows html5 input types and polyfills the html5 validation behavior for older browsers. So only integer value is allowed where this directive is given. Angularjs monitors the state of the form and input fields input, textarea, select, and lets you notify the user about the current state. Oct 27, 2017 in this article, i am going to explain how to generate pdf file from an html page using angularjs in sharepoint. In this article, i am going to explain how to generate pdf file from an html page using angularjs in sharepoint.
This is the primary example of image upload in angular 8. How to use ngmodel in angularjs with examples guru99. When this css rule is loaded by the browser, all html elements including their children that are tagged with the ngcloak directive are hidden. New angular 8 upload file or image tutorial example tuts. The htmlelement property hidden is a boolean which is true if the element is hidden.
Elementref is a service that grants direct access to the dom element through its nativeelement property. Js building a chat application in go and react building security tools in go. Jan 23, 2016 in this article we will get a short overview on angularjs, then we will create a asp. In this article we will get a short overview on angularjs, then we will create a asp. Apr 15, 2017 angular cloud computer science python golang rust vuejs web dev projects hackernews clone in vuejs building a vuejs blog on aws building an imgur clone with vue. Angularjs formatted input fields jsfiddle code playground.
The microsyntax parser translates that string into attributes on the. Angularjs tutorial, angularjs tutorial pdf, angularjs, angularjs example, angular ajax example, angular filter example, angular controller. Well learn about the ngform, ngmodel and ngsubmit directives which are the essential concepts in templatebased forms and how to create an authentication system with node and express. Lets see the directory structure of angular we need to follow. See the angular syntax in this live example download example. Below youll find a couple of different methods that you can use to pass hidden data to any form submission using angularjs. Angular is the name for the angular of today and tomorrow. Angularjs add remove input fields dynamically with php mysqli by hardik savani january 14, 2018 category. If you are new to angular 9, then check out my angular 9 tutorial for handling the uploaded files at the backend server, we use the multer.
It provides the capability to create single page application in a very clean and maintainable way. You can find more options on ng2fileupload official documentation. While the value is not displayed to the user in the pages content. In every chapter, you can edit the examples online, and click on a. There is no default binding provided by angular to input typefile. Specifically, data binding and event handling via ngmodel is unsupported for input file. The type attribute specifies the type of element to display. Angularjs add remove input fields dynamically with php. Thus, it gives user a rich and responsive experience. In this angular image upload demo, we will use the ng2fileupload library to upload a file to the node server. The type attribute specifies the type of input element to display. I think the intention with vmodel on hidden inputs is to set up a oneway binding, in which case its much better to use input type hidden. Decorators are functions that modify javascript classes.
We install angular using angular 9 cli and then start working on this angular file upload demo. As explained earlier in this post, angular 2 directly uses the valid html dom element properties and events unlike angularjs 1. Angularjs also holds information about whether they have been touched, or modified, or not. During change detection, angular automatically updates the data property with the dom propertys value. This tutorial works with angular 6 forms and authentication are. See the angular syntax in this live example download example template basicslink. Also, see the uploads folder to see if the image is saved or not. The input variables in this example are hero, i, and odd. Angular 987 file upload example angular image upload. Binding to these events provides a way to get input from the user. Unless we generate pdf files with the sharepoint list data, we cant take it out of. This ended up being an interesting little problem for me during one of my programming sessions. In this tutorial, well learn to use the templatedriven approach in angular 7 to work with forms. Lets look at an example of how we can use the ngmodel with the textbox and checkbox input type.
Well merge pull requests and create new releases, but not actively solve issues. Php bootstrap mysql angular today i would like to share with you how to implement add more add and remove textbox dynamically using angularjs with php. In this step we need to create a project, so click on the create project and create your project. In this template we will create file input element that allows to us to choose the file and a button to submit. You could solve this problem by hiding that div by doing display. The nghide directive shows or hides the given html element based on the.
In angularjs, the nghide directive shows or hides the associated html element based on an expression. Angular cloud computer science python golang rust vuejs web dev projects hackernews clone in vuejs building a vuejs blog on aws building an imgur clone with vue. To bind to a dom event, surround the dom event name in parentheses and assign a quoted template statement to it. Go to the latest angular this site and all of its contents are referring to angularjs version 1. Google places autocomplete fill input example without. Finally, angular 8 file upload tutorial with example.
Asking for help, clarification, or responding to other answers. Since angular doesnt naturally bind this input, use onchange on the input, like above. This angularjs directive use as classattribute, follow angularjs example given below. The approach for creating a structural behavior is exactly the same. Angularjs is distributed as a javascript file, and can be added to a web page with a script tag. To use the new myhighlight, inside a template that applies the directive as an attribute to a. Componentbased webapps with angularjs jan varwig jan. The hidden property applies to all presentation modes and should not be used to hide content that is meant to be directly accessible to the user. In the previous section, we saw how to create an attribute directive using angular. A hidden field often stores what database record that needs to be updated when the form is submitted. This guide helps you transition from angularjs to angular by mapping angularjs syntax to the equivalent angular syntax. But then, file input is realonly to javascript, the only benefit such a binding could help is on clearing the fileinput. Then you will learn everything else you need to know about angularjs.
Angular creates a new instance of the directives class for each matching element, injecting an angular elementref into the constructor. This section provides a huge collection of angularjs interview questions with their answers hidden in a box to challenge you to have a go at them before discovering the correct answer. Angularjs uses dependency injection and make use of separation of concerns. Hence the below output will be shown, in which the word angular will be hidden. Specifically, data binding and event handling via ngmodel is unsupported for inputfile. Angular 2 online test if you are preparing to appear for a java and angularjs framework related certification exam, then this section is a must for you. The properties of a component or a directive are hidden from binding by default. Feb 04, 2015 mamr changed the title ngmodel doesnt change input hidden field value ngmodel doesnt change the value of input tag case type is hidden feb 4, 2015 this comment has been minimized. But dont use hidden attribute with angular 2 to showhide elements. Jsfiddle or its authors are not responsible or liable for any.
When we click on the hide angular button the property value of true will sent to the nghide directive. How to get the hidden inputs value by using angularjs. Thanks for contributing an answer to stack overflow. Bind hidden inputs to model in angular stack overflow. I get that there really should be no notion of twoway data. Angularjs is what html would have been, had it been designed for building webapps. Not every feature offered is available for all input types. The ngclass directive allows you to dynamically set css classes on an html element by databinding an expression that represents all classes to be added the directive operates in three different ways, depending on which of three types the expression evaluates to. Angular also doesnt provide framework support to ajax upload of. It enhances the file input functionality further, by offering support to. The let keyword declares a template input variable that you reference within the template. Before start learning file upload, we need a angular 8 project. The name of the dom property to which the input property is bound. Decorator that marks a class field as an input property and supplies configuration metadata.
You can use angular event bindings to respond to any dom event. You will also learn about custom directives in angular. Solved it by using a javascript library called filesaver. If the expression evaluates to a string, the string should be one or more spacedelimited class names. A hidden field let web developers include data that cannot be seen or modified by users when a form is submitted. Angularjs directive for only integer input can use to restrict the value other than integer. This section simulates a real online test along with a given timer which challenges you to complete the test within a given timeframe. Angularjs is a javascript framework written in javascript. Test your javascript, css, html or coffeescript online with jsfiddle code editor.
The nghide directive shows or hides the given html element based on the expression provided to the nghide attribute the element is shown or hidden by removing or adding the. The directive embeds the full viewer, which allows you to scroll through the pdf. Since angular doesnt naturally bind this input, use onchange on. This is quite different from using the css property display to control the visibility of an element. Continuous view all pages are inserted into the dom when the pdf is loaded lazy page rendering render a page only when it enters the viewport for the first time. The type attribute is not a required attribute, but we think you should always include it. Lets create an angular project by using the following command. Angular directive for displaying pdf files using pdf. So in place of ng, ngsrc, ngshow and nghide, angular 2 uses, src and hidden properties to get the same result. You can add angularjs event listeners to your html elements by using one or more of these directives. Declarative templates with databinding, mvc, dependency injection and great testability story all implemented with pure clientside javascript. If a nonnumber is entered in the input, the browser will report the value as an empty string, which means the view model values in ngmodel and subsequently the scope value will also be an empty string.
In browsers that follow the html5 specification, input number does not work as expected with ngmodeloptions. I am using to view the pdf i have pdf viewer in modal pop up. You dont need hidden fields at all, as the all the scope variables which are not in the form can be taken as hidden variables. Angular 2, gives cannot read property length of undefined while calling a function from another components 0 cannot read property of value undefined in angular 4. Keep ready the pdf design and hide it until you download. The input type hidden defines a hidden input field. By following users and tags, you can catch up information on technical fields that you are interested in as a whole.
256 676 1208 18 294 46 150 43 470 1371 493 70 1224 220 1021 444 261 297 520 167 1036 410 539 1122 935 959 204 1324 1366 31 920 757 726 32 1470 460 159 1396 524 560 924 300 101 379 323 929